SAE-AISI H11 Steel vs. EN 1.5805 Steel

Both SAE-AISI H11 steel and EN 1.5805 steel are iron alloys. They have a moderately high 93% of their average alloy composition in common. There are 23 material properties with values for both materials. Properties with values for just one material (3, in this case) are not shown.

For each property being compared, the top bar is SAE-AISI H11 steel and the bottom bar is EN 1.5805 steel.
